National Games 2023: Nagaland ends 12-year medal drought, wins bronze in Pencak Silat Regu

Nagaland's Liike Kibami, Hinokali, and Avikali V Sheqi won the bronze medal in the National Games 2023 to end their medal drought

Nagaland’s decade-long medal drought at the National Games has come to an end. The Women’s team from the state secured bronze in Pencak Silat Regu, a combative sport at the ongoing Games in Goa.

Nagaland’s Liike Kibami, Hinokali, and Avikali V Sheqi won the bronze medal in the sport. With that they ended the 12-year medal drought for the state in the Games.

Pencak Silat Regu is a sport reportedly originating from Indonesia. The Nagaland’s trio lost the semifinal and were awarded the bronze. Delhi emerged as the champion in the category, while the silver went to Haryana. Punjab is also another losing semifinalists.

It is Nagaland’s first medal at the National Games since the 2011. Back in the edition held in Ranchi, Jharkhand, the State won 2 bronze medals. After 2011, the National Games were held only twice in 2015 and 2022. Nagaland failed to win any medals in both the editions of the Games.

As of October 28, Maharashtra was leading the mdeal tally with 78 medals followed by Haryana with 33 medals and Services Sports Control Board- 21 medals. The 2023 edition of the National Games will conclude on November 9.
